Science How are animals grouped? Page 38 – 43. Important words – Trait are body features passed on to an animal from its parents. Example eye color – Vertebrate is an animal with a backbone. Examples are fish, amphibians, reptiles, birds, and mammals. – Fish live their entire lives in water, have slippery scales, and breathe through their gills – Amphibians are frogs, toads, and salamanders. They spend part of their lives in water and part on land. – Reptiles have dry, scaly skin. Reptiles include snakes, lizards, turtles, crocodiles, and alligators. – Birds are vertebrates with feathers and bills that do not have teeth – Mammals have hair or fur and feed their babies milk.

Science Invertebrates are animals that do not have backbones. – Examples are sea jellies, worms, mollusks, and arthropods
